Relax: Each person's
experience with malignant mesothelioma is unique, but it is
certain that once one is diagnosed with malignant mesothelioma,
life is forever altered. Just as each person's mesothelioma
treatment is individualized, so is the coping strategy he or
she will develop. Everyone can, however, improve their energy
level and promote healthy cell growth by getting adequate rest
and relaxation, good nutrition, some exercise and some fun!
Many will want to review their priorities and reduce undesirable
activities in light of what is really important in their life.
To the extent possible, one must take it one day at a time,
avoiding the stress that comes with trying to organize and plan
in the face of uncertainty. The Mayo Clinic recommends the following
for all cancer patients:
- Learn relaxation techniques
- Share your feelings honestly
with family, friends, a spiritual advisor or a counselor
- Keep a journal to help organize
your thoughts
- When faced with a difficult decision,
list pros and cons for each choice
- Find a source of spiritual strength
- Pray or meditate
- Find time to be alone
- Go for walks
- Remain involved with work and
leisure activities to the extent possible

Relate: When diagnosed with a rare
disease such as malignant mesothelioma, it is easy to slip into
thinking that no one else understands. It is normal to grieve
when you have lost something-be it health, energy, strength,
hair or even hope. You may feel sad, lonely, fearful or angry.
These are the times it is most important to resist any temptation
to isolate. Talking to someone about your feelings, frustrations
and concerns can help. Sharing with others, especially those
similarly diagnosed, can prove a source of strength for both
of you. If you have access to the internet, there are "chat
rooms" where you can talk to other mesothelioma patients
across the globe. You can also find support groups within your
community that might meet near your home, or perhaps at the
hospital where you are being treated.
Of course, if you are feeling in crisis and
think you need to speak with a professional to deal with all
of the changes and sudden stress, please tell your nurse.

Restoration: The physical and psychological
strain of malignant mesothelioma can be severe. To top it
off, treatments meant to heal often cause unexpected and irritating
side effects. It is therefore important to gather as much
information as you can about how malignant mesothelioma progresses
as a disease, what side effects to expect from the treatment
you select and how to minimize them, how you can help your
body fight infection, and how you can keep your mind strong.
